As the godfather of Dogecoin and a leading influencer, Musk has been making every effort to endorse Dogecoin. Musk has not only attracted more and more investors around the world to pay attention to Dogecoin, but also caused its price to fluctuate greatly. According to industry insiders, Musk has repeatedly called orders and promoted DOGE on social platforms when DOGE was at a low level. For example, this time the Twitter icon was changed to DOGE, and DOGE rose by more than 20% overnight. In the early hours of today, Musk changed the Twitter homepage logo to the original blue dove pattern, and Dogecoin fell by 9%.
